Latest Patents: One of Michael's latest patents is the "Seat back assembly with integral reinforcement structure." This innovative design features a frame made of low-density material, specifically expanded polypropylene (EPP), which includes a reinforcement structure encapsulated within it. The reinforcement structure has a load transferring surface that extends between opposite ends, with both ends securely attached to a vehicle body structure. This unique feature allows the assembly to distribute loads effectively, maintaining the structural integrity of the frame under predetermined loads.
